Cooking InstructionsHide images
step 1
You'll want the pan close to the broiler so set the oven tray as close as possible to the top.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
step 2
Blanch the Bok Choy (1 bunch) (optional) for just a few seconds, then lay them out in a single layer on a baking sheet or baking dish. Drizzle a little bit of Olive Oil (as needed) onto the veggies. Add Salt (to taste) and Ground Black Pepper (to taste).
step 3
Lay the Bacon (3 slices) over the veggies in a single layer. The bacon will cook very quickly so be sure to keep an eye on the dish. It should take only about 5 minutes.
